THE ULTRASTRUCTURE OF RAT LIVER AFTER REPEATED INTRAVENOUS ADMINISTRATION OF NANOPARTICLES OF MAGNETITE

Abstract

The liver of rats after repeated intravenous application of nanomagnetite suspension (2 g(Fe3O4)/kg of body weight) was investigated by a method of transmission electronic microscopy. No damaging effect of magnetite on the main cellular populations of liver in the given dose was revealed. Accumulation of particles of magnetite into phagosomes of Kupfer cells is shown. Single particles of magnetite are visualized in cytoplasm hepatocytes.
